I just replaced my Blower Motor Resistor and my Blower motor, The heating is great but it only comes out of the floor vents and the defroster. I do not feel any air coming out of the vents on the dash. Please help cause it is severely cold here in INDIANA. If possible would someone please post a tutorial on how to do this.
Re: Heating Issue
Posted: Sun Jan 16, 2011 12:23 am
by LeSabre in Buffalo
It's the HVAC vacuum actuator behind the glovebox. Either that, or a vacuum leak somewhere in the lines leading to it. IIRC, if it's broken/no vacuum or off, it defaults to floor vents.

An SE doesn't have the airmix actuator behind the glovebox. That's ECC equipped cars only.
Check the vacuum lines near the programmer above the right front hushpanel. Also make sure the line coming through the firewall from the motor has vacuum and is connected.

problem solved. I replaced the vacuum tank (big blimp object in front of passenger side tire) line because it was completely severed. Heating works great on every vent

Ed, the Evap canister is on the DRIVER'S side, the vacuum tank for the ECC was relocated to the wheelwell on the passenger side in 1996.
